The interface lowering pass used a separate formatter for method
signatures. Same-named local aliases could therefore make distinct generic
methods compare equal. Reuse getTypeCodeName so interface checks preserve
type identity.
x/tools SSA names and go/types strings can preserve the source spelling of
type arguments, so aliases can make distinct instances collide. Use the
canonical type encoding for function names, synthetic local type owners,
instantiated named types, and method sets.
Add cases where same-named local aliases instantiate generic functions,
local types, and methods with float32 and float64. Record the current
collisions and incorrect results.
